Exclusive Food Content
Vice positioned itself to launch exclusive food content from its food vertical Munchies on OnlyFans—”a subscription site in which fans can pay creators directly for exclusive content.” The brand did not only become the first media publisher to make an account on the platform, but this is also its second foray into a direct-to-consumer subscription service. In late 2020, users gained access to exclusive food content from Munchies through OnlyFans for only $4.99 USD per month. Currently, the offering consists of up-close shots of food being made. This makes for a certain type of ASMR experience as audiences enjoy a more intimate look into preparation, while also witnessing the transformation and interaction of different foods. For the future, Vice plans to include other types of exclusive food content such as videos with chefs, and more.Image Credit: Vice
